Mosiebaby is a simple, FDA-approved, and clinically proven insemination kit that can be used in the comfort and privacy of one’s own home. It works by bypassing the cervix, allowing sperm to be placed directly at the entrance of the uterus, increasing the chances of conception. The kit includes a syringe and an extension tube, making the process easy and mess-free.
